+{-------------------------------------------------------}
+{ Differences with TP Graph unit:                       }
+{ -  default putimage and getimage only support a max.  }
+{    of 64K colors on screen, because all pixels are    }
+{    saved as words.                                    }
+{ -  Set RGB Palette is not used, SetPalette must be    }
+{    used instead.                                      }
+{ -  In the TP graph unit, Clipping is always performed }
+{    on strings written with OutText, and this clipping }
+{    is done on a character per character basis (for    }
+{    example, if ONE part of a character is outside the }
+{    viewport , then that character is not written at   }
+{    all to the screen. In FPC Pascal, clipping is done }
+{    on a PIXEL basis, not a character basis, so part of }
+{    characters which are not entirely in the viewport  }
+{    may appear on the screen.                          }
+{ -  SetTextStyle only conforms to the TP version when  }
+{    the correct (and expected) values are used for     }
+{    CharSize for stroked fonts (4 = stroked fonts)     }
+{ -  InstallUserDriver is not supported, so always      }
+{    returns an error.                                  }
+{ -  RegisterBGIDriver is not supported, so always      }
+{    returns an error.                                  }
+{ - DrawPoly XORPut mode is not exactly the same as in  }
+{   the TP graph unit.                                  }
+{ - Imagesize returns a longint instead of a word       }
+{ - ImageSize cannot return an error value              }
+{-------------------------------------------------------}
